It was a relatively quiet week for the industry as appointments within the broking sector – a regular hive of recruitment – were few and far between, with the only notable activity in the sector coming in the form of the departure of veteran A&A Group director Steve McPherson. Elsewhere, Questgates led the way for the loss adjusting community with the addition of Allan Hunter to its major loss team, while movers and shakers among insurers involved specialist operation HSB Engineering and Allianz Global Corporate and Specialty Africa.
